Step 1: Inspection and Assessment
Our team will arrive at your home and conduct a thorough inspection to identify the source of the damage and assess the extent of the damage. We’ll use our advanced equipment to find out the moisture levels in your home and develop a plan to dry it out.
Step 2: Containment and Preparation
Our team will set up containment procedures to prevent further damage to your home and belongings. We’ll move furniture and belongings out of the affected area and cover the floors and surfaces with plastic to prevent further damage.
Step 3: Drying and Extraction
Our team will use specialized drying equipment to dry out your home, including dehumidifiers and fans. We’ll also extract water from the affected area using our powerful pumps.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Once the drying process is complete, our team will clean and sanitize the affected area to prevent the growth of mold and mildew.
Step 5: Restoration and Repair
Finally, our team will work with you to restore and repair your home to its original condition. This may include repairing or replacing damaged drywall, ceilings, and floors.

Residential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ak in the kitchen | Yes | No | Small leaks are usually easy to fix and won’t cause significant damage. |
| Roof leak with water damage | No | Yes | Roof leaks can cause significant damage and need specialized equipment to fix. |
| Water damage in the basement with standing water | No | Yes | Standing water can cause mold growth and need specialized equipment to remove. |
| Water damage in a small area with minimal damage | Maybe | Yes | Even small areas of water damage can cause significant issues if not properly addressed. |
| Water damage in a large area with extensive damage | No | Yes | Extensive water damage needs specialized equipment and expertise to properly address. |
| Water damage with mold growth | No | Yes | Mold growth can cause serious health issues and need specialized equipment to remove. |

Residential Water Damage Restoration Cost in Southborough, MA
The cost of residential water damage restoration can vary widely dep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Southborough, MA. Our team will provide you with a free estimate and work with you to develop a customized restoration plan that fits your budget and needs.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Emergency Response | $500 – $2,500 | Severity of the damage, time of day, and availability of equipment. |
| Moisture Reading and Assessment | $200 – $1,000 | Size of the affected area, type of damage, and equipment costs. |
| Drying and Extraction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of the affected area, type of equipment used, and labor costs. |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$500 – $2,000 | Size of the affected area, type of cleaning products used, and labor costs. |
| Restoration and Repair |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of the affected area, type of materials used, and labor costs. |
| Follow-up and Inspection | $200 – $1,000 | Size of the affected area, type of equipment used, and labor costs. |
